Hot water tanks are a common household appliance that many of us take for granted We use them daily for tasks such as showering, doing dishes, and washing clothes However, what many people don’t realize is that hot water tanks can be a breeding ground for harmful bacteria, including Legionella, the bacteria responsible for causing Legionnaires’ disease.
Legionnaires’ disease is a severe form of pneumonia caused by inhaling the Legionella bacteria This can happen when water droplets containing the bacteria are inhaled into the lungs While the disease is rare, it can be life-threatening, especially for those with compromised immune systems or underlying health conditions.
Hot water tanks are a perfect environment for Legionella bacteria to thrive The warm temperatures of the water, combined with the fact that the bacteria can grow in biofilm that accumulates in the tank, make it an ideal breeding ground Additionally, as hot water tanks are often dark and damp, they provide the perfect conditions for the bacteria to multiply.
One of the most common ways that Legionella bacteria can enter a hot water tank is through the municipal water supply While water treatment plants work hard to ensure that the water is safe to drink, Legionella bacteria can still be present in small amounts Once the bacteria enter the hot water tank, they can quickly multiply and spread throughout the system.
Another way that hot water tanks can become contaminated is through stagnant water If a hot water tank is not used regularly, such as in a vacation home or rental property, the water can become stagnant, providing the perfect breeding ground for Legionella bacteria It is crucial to regularly flush out the hot water tank if it is not in constant use to prevent this bacteria from multiplying.

Legionella bacteria cannot survive at these high temperatures, so keeping the water hot can help prevent their growth.
Regularly flushing out the hot water tank can also help prevent the buildup of biofilm, where Legionella bacteria can hide and multiply Flushing the tank involves draining a certain amount of water from the tank to help remove any potential buildup It is essential to follow the manufacturer’s instructions when flushing out the hot water tank to ensure that it is done correctly.
Installing a point-of-use water heater can also help reduce the risk of Legionnaires’ disease These devices heat water on demand, so there is no need for a hot water tank to store water By heating water as needed, point-of-use water heaters can help prevent the growth of Legionella bacteria that can occur in hot water tanks.
Regular maintenance of hot water tanks is crucial in preventing Legionnaires’ disease This includes cleaning the tank, checking for leaks, and ensuring that the temperature is set correctly Hiring a professional to inspect and maintain the hot water tank can help ensure that it is safe and free from harmful bacteria.
